In Amravati
Raymond inaugurated a Greenfield Linen manufacturing facility in the newly created Textile Park in Nandgaon Peth, Amravati, under its subsidiary Raymond Luxury Cottons on 17 December 2017.In phase 1 of the industrial development initiative, the facility is expected to produce 1200 tons of world class Linen yarns and 4.8 million meters of Linen and blended fabrics per annum. It is expected to generate direct and indirect employment for 800 people.
Reaffirming its commitment for the inclusive growth of the society, Raymond in yet another initiative has laid a foundation stone for establishing an education, sports and residential project benefitting the entire industrial region of Amravati, Maharashtra.
